  • How do I batch convert separate avi files in Premiere Elements 11 to separate mp4 files

    How do I batch convert separate avi files to separate mp4 files

    For batch conversions, I use DigitalMedia Converter by Deskshare. My version is an older one (2.7), and there is a newer version, in two flavors, "regular" and "pro." I do not recall what limit on number of files is, but have had about 10 in the conversion queue. The newer version, and especially the Pro version, has probably expanded the number of files in the queue, but I could not quickly find what that max number is. While not opensource freeware, my copy was only about US$40. I was so impressed, that I bought two licenses - one for each of my editing computers. I have been meaning to upgrade to the new Pro version, but as old 2.7 works for what I need to do, just have not gotten around to it.
    Now, Premiere Pro can do batch conversions too, through the AME (Adobe Media Encoder), but that would be a much, much more expensive solution.
    I am certain that there are other conversion programs (some might also be free), that can do batch conversions, and with the H.264 CODEC for your MP4 output.
    One caveat: if your AVI files are SD (Standard Def), you will NOT be pleased if you convert to MP4 in HD (High Def), as there will be up-rezzing, and the results will not be pretty. If you need to up-rez to HD, when using SD material, you might want to look into something like Red Giant's Magic Bullet Instant HD. Many users have been impressed by its up-rezzing capabilities, though some have not.
    Also, I think that Corel's video editor has an up-rezzing capability, but have never used it, so cannot comment directly - might be great, or not so great.

  • How many hours of high quality music fits on a 16 gigabyte iPod

    How many hours of high quality music fits on a 16 gigabyte iPod?  

    A "16Gb" iPod nano has enough room to store about 14.5Gb of music, assuming this to be the only media stored there.  If by "high quality" you mean lossless, using Apple Lossless/ALAC format, that equates to around 30 hours of music (there will be some variations depending on the nature of the music and the degree to which ALAC compresses the audio data).  AIFF files are larger, though of the same quality as ALAC - maximum in this case is approx. 20 hours.
    For "iTunes Plus" quality (256kbps lossy compression) files will be between one-third and one-quarter the size of the same music in ALAC, so the total time goes up to around 90-120 hours.  My 16Gb 7th gen nano is currently full to capacity using a mix of 256kbps AAC and 320kbps MP3 files - iTunes reports the total time as 4.9 days (117 hours).

  • How to burn a high-quality audio cd in iTunes 9.0.2?

    how to burn a high-quality audio cd in iTunes 9.0.2?

    snowmens wrote:
    how to burn a high-quality audio cd in iTunes 9.0.2?
    It is not possible to burn a high-quality audio CD in any version of iTunes.
    iTunes burning is designed for quick, convenient burns directly from a playlist.
    iTunes does not do the proper volume normalization or silence suppression that is required for a high-quality finished product.
    If you are striving for quality, you can consider dedicated burning programs such as Toast, Nero, or Roxio.

  • How to export HD-project to .avi including HD-quality and timecodes

    Hi,
    I have an iMovie HD 6 project that I have imported from my Sony HDR-HC3 HD video camera. The project is a HD-1080i-25 project. I want to export this project to an AVI keeping the HD quality (same quality as the DV-tape). What settings should I use to make this happen? I don’t want to export it as a QuickTime .mov file but as an .AVI file that I am able to play in a media player that supports HD. I also want to keep the 16:9 format and timecodes. One other purpose with this file is as a backup (if the DV-tape should be damaged) so it must be possible to import it into iMovie again if that should be necessary.
    Is all this possible?
    Thanks in advance.
    Jarle

    Your best option is to export to .dv using the Full Quality DV preset. It will preserve all quality including the timecode.
    On the other hand the Expert export settinngs of iMovie 5 and 6 are buggy because exporting via the expert settings as a DV stream or .avi deinterlaces video and loses the timestamp!!
    Workarounds: Export .dv via the Full Quality preset (this is more convenient anyway). Exporting as .dv (or DV-encoded .avi) via QuickTime Player Pro also preserves interlacing and timecode.
    http://www.sjoki.uta.fi/~shmhav/iMovieHD_6_bugs.html#expertsettings
    If you export via QuickTime Player Pro, then use the following settings:
    Export: Movie to DV Stream
    DV Format: DV
    Video format: PAL (I am European)
    Scan: Interlaced (notice that this option only sets the corresponding flag -- it does not do ANYTHING else to the video!)
    Aspect Ratio: 16:9 (this options also sets the corresponding flag so other apps can properly treat the file)
    Audio Format Rate: 48.000 kHz (I believe there is not much difference between locked vs unlocked audio -- unlocked seems to be the default)
